A Crucial Lifeline: Malaysia Defies Global Energy Crisis with Aggressive Agro MADANI Price Slashes
By ruthlessly cutting out the middlemen and leveraging targeted agricultural subsidies, the government’s direct-from-farm initiative is securing national food supplies and protecting consumers from crippling inflation.
JOHOR BAHRU, MALAYSIA, April 20 — In a major development that offers a crucial lifeline to consumers battered by the escalating global energy crisis, the Malaysian government is aggressively rolling out its 'Jualan Agro MADANI' initiative to stabilize domestic food security. As relentless inflation and supply chain disruptions place international commodity markets under severe scrutiny, authorities in Malaysia are taking a hardline, interventionist approach to fiercely protect the grassroots economy. By facilitating a massive, direct-from-farm to consumer sales pipeline, the program is effectively shielding vulnerable households from brutal price shocks. The initiative guarantees that essential daily necessities remain easily accessible and highly affordable, proving that localized agricultural strategies can successfully neutralize the devastating economic ripple effects of international volatility.
The profound success of this ongoing initiative was heavily underscored today during a high-profile, bustling agricultural market event in Johor. Speaking directly to the press, Federal Agricultural Marketing Authority (FAMA) Director-General Abdul Rashid Bahri delivered a highly reassuring update on the nation's fragile food reserves. He categorically confirmed that despite mounting external logistical pressures, current market prices for essential goods remain remarkably stable and national stockpiles are entirely sufficient to meet daily consumer demand. The definitive secret behind this economic resilience lies in the ruthless elimination of traditional corporate middlemen. By directly connecting hardworking rural producers with the urban consumer base, the Agro MADANI sales approach ensures that final retail prices are aggressively slashed by a staggering 10 to 30 percent below standard market rates, providing immediate, desperately needed financial relief to everyday shoppers.
Behind the scenes, sources reveal that the true backbone of this price stability is a highly strategic, state-sponsored financial safety net explicitly designed to absorb global logistical shocks. Abdul Rashid highlighted the critical impact of the government’s targeted diesel subsidy frameworks, notably the BUDI Agri-Komoditi and the BUDI Diesel Individu initiatives. By injecting a direct monthly subsidy of RM400 into the pockets of eligible farmers and local distributors, the government has effectively neutralized the soaring costs of agricultural transportation. This vital economic buffer ensures that producers are under absolutely no immediate pressure to hike the prices of their raw goods. Furthermore, this aggressive state backing is actively generating a massive economic windfall for domestic agriculture; participating local entrepreneurs are currently witnessing a remarkable, positive surge in their monthly incomes, taking home an additional RM3,000 to RM5,000. This dual-pronged strategy guarantees that both the producer and the consumer are equally protected from the relentless squeeze of inflation.
The sheer scale and popularity of the program were on full, vibrant display at the Johor event today, which rapidly transformed into a major commercial hub for the local community. The sprawling market brought together 30 ambitious local entrepreneurs under one roof, with FAMA officially targeting a massive footfall of up to 2,000 visitors and projecting total daily sales to effortlessly breach the RM100,000 mark. The electric atmosphere was fueled by aggressive promotional pricing that drew massive crowds, prominently featuring the highly sought-after RM5 MADANI combo sets that bundle essential household groceries into an ultra-affordable package. Shoppers also eagerly capitalized on heavily discounted premium domestic commodities, including top-tier durians, pineapples, and bananas.
